Barricaid - A Climber's Route to Recovery

by Jeremy C. Wang, M.D. | 2 years ago

Diego is a multisport athlete that loves skydiving, cycling, mountain climbing, and other extreme sports. Diego was training for a triathlon and was hit head on by a truck and nearly died. A herniated disc was one of the many injuries that he suffered. Years later, Diego was rear-ended and reherniated his disc. Diego and his surgeon chose Barricaid to close the hole in the disc and reduce his risk
